Transaction ab43ee3a033bc2e7a3c40264302b2e9c6a22132faaad4b64c17088635ea90c26

1 Input
2 Outputs
  • ab43ee3a033bc2e7a3c40264302b2e9c6a22132faaad4b64c17088635ea90c26:0
  • value  83277966
    address  38x58BRTsX68Xv4njkQuMUZjgCMi4wnNia
  • ab43ee3a033bc2e7a3c40264302b2e9c6a22132faaad4b64c17088635ea90c26:1
  • value  19950000
    address  1B2YovUuXfygtU7WXshh5T3SsjLPm2DBVL